Participating in a Virtual IOP allows Dothan residents to engage in structured therapy without the hassle of commuting. This means you can focus on recovery while maintaining your work, school, and family commitments. With options for individual, group, and family therapy available, individuals can find the support they need, whether it’s dealing with depression, anxiety, PTSD, or substance use disorders.

Getting started with a Virtual IOP is seamless. Most programs offer 9 to 20 hours of therapy each week, conducted via HIPAA-compliant video conferencing, ensuring privacy and security. With sessions typically 3-5 days a week lasting 3-4 hours, it’s an effective way to receive professional help.
